Holding its first meeting of the year at the ICC headquarters, which was chaired by N Srinivasan and presided by Mustafa Kamal in the presence of all the full-member and associate representatives, the board took some major decisions issued quite a few directives to the cricket world. The apex cricket body approved the dates for its main events through to 2019, following its Board meeting yesterday. Though the tournaments were awarded to the countries in 2013, the dates were approved during this two-day meeting.
